| TIP | VTIP | |
|---|---|---|
| Name | iShares TIPS Bond ETF | Vanguard Short-Term Inflation-Protected Securities Index Fund ETF Shares |
| Category | Inflation-Protected Bond | Short-Term Inflation-Protected Bond |
| Style | Passive | Passive |
| Expense ratio | 0.18% | 0.04% |
| Assets (AUM) | $14.6B | $71.2B |
| Dividend yield | 4.47% | 4.16% |
| Avg volume (3-mo) | 1.8M | 2.4M |
| Inception | December 4, 2003 | October 12, 2012 |
| Benchmark proxy | Bloomberg US TIPS | Bloomberg US Aggregate Bond |
The provider doesn't break out holdings for TIP — overlap can't be computed.
VTIP costs 0.14 pp less per year — about $14.00 per $10,000 invested.
